DISCUSSION:

On April 7, 2015, the Board adopted the Humboldt County Emergency Operations Plan to guide and direct emergency and disaster response efforts in Humboldt County. On June 27, 2023, the Board adopted the Mass Care and Shelter Plan (MCP) and MCP Appendix as a supporting Functional Annex to the Humboldt County Emergency Operations Plan (EOP). The MCP  outlined Humboldt County’s response for mass care and shelter associated with large-scale disasters.

 

Development and execution of Memoranda of Agreement with multiple community partners is a necessary preparatory step toward timely implementation of emergency operations. These agreements lay the groundwork for the DHHS Emergency Preparedness Program and the Sheriff’s Office of Emergency Services to quickly provide emergency shelter and support services to disaster-displaced individuals in the Humboldt Operational Area.

 

SOURCE OF FUNDING: 

No funds will be expended pursuant to these Memoranda of Agreement.

 

FINANCIAL IMPACT:

This agreement quantifies a zero cost to the parties entering an agreement and no money exchanges hands during operations of a shelter at a facility.

 

STAFFING IMPACT:

This action will have no direct effect on staffing levels. The existence of these Memoranda of Agreement will allow existing staff to mobilize more quickly and efficiently during disasters.
